488,296 is a composite number, even.
488,296 (four hundred eighty-eight thousand two hundred ninety-six)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2³ × 67 × 911. Written other ways, in hexadecimal, 0x77368.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 488296, here are decompositions:
- 47 + 488249 = 488296
- 89 + 488207 = 488296
- 227 + 488069 = 488296
- 239 + 488057 = 488296
- 293 + 488003 = 488296
- 317 + 487979 = 488296
- 353 + 487943 = 488296
- 467 + 487829 = 488296
Showing the first eight; more decompositions exist.
